The best fics are the ones that recognize that although Luke Skywalker may APPEAR on the outside to be a normal friendly twink who happens to have cool powers, especially when contrasted with such ship partners as Boba or Din or even Han, he is arguably the scariest person alive in the galaxy around the prequel era. AND, crucially, he is also a fundamentally weird guy. This man was homeschooled on a rural farm his entire life and then apprenticed to a swamp gremlin who showed him how to tap into the cosmic power of the universe. He blew up the death star age 19, killing approx 2 million-ish Imperials. He is a vortex of Force power that can communicate with the ghosts of dead Jedi. He’s staring into the distance and mumbling to himself and doing Yoda aphorisms and casually pulling out the “yeah I could crush that guy into a paste with my mind (:” and nobody around him knows what to do with that. I think he is a character who has very little frame of reference for how a Jedi or a person in general is supposed to act and there is some thing about him that is by necessity really fucking weird and a little scary but he’s so nice that it can throw you off the scent a little bit. I mean this in the nicest way possible, but why do so many people think that criticizing the Jedi is bad? The Jedi are and were never perfect. They can never be a perfect order who does everything right and never makes mistakes. Frankly, I can write an entire essay on their flaws.
It is okay that they were flawed. That doesn’t mean you can’t root for them. I root for them. I deeply love them and their lore. The Great Jedi Purge was a tragedy that they didn’t deserve. But acting like they’re an untouchable institution is not only just straight up wrong, but also just really boring?? The imperfections of the Order and those involved give the Jedi nuance and make them feel incredibly real and interesting. Things are not black and white in Star Wars. Let yourself feel conflicted about the Jedi and wish for them to succeed anyway. It’s more exciting that way, I promise.
